Pouilly-Fuissé ‘Les Vignes du Château’ is a blend of grapes from Château Vitallis’ historic 13th-century plots. The vines, with an average age of 35 years, are planted on clay-limestone Jurassic soils, and bring richness to the wine.
The vintage 2023 of Pouilly-Fuissé ‘Les Vignes du Château’ is a bright, pale gold. It is very open on the nose and expresses notes of hawthorn, acacia blossom and citrus fruit, entwined with a light touch of spice. The attack is crisp, with good acidity, but this develops gradually to give the impression of fullness. It shows pronounced notes of candied citrus fruit and a zesty mineral finish.
